Currently, Sodexo is seeking a highly motivated Environmental Services / Custodial Manager 2 to join its healthcare account team at Jackson Holtz Children’s Hospital, located in Miami, FL. Jackson Holtz Children’s Hospital is a reputable facility with 250 licensed beds and is part of the larger Jackson Health System, known for providing advanced pediatric care with a commitment to excellence in patient outcomes. This position plays a pivotal role in maintaining a clean, safe, and welcoming environment for patients, visitors, and staff alike.

The Environmental Services / Custodial Manager 2 will oversee the first shift operations, leading a team of over 40 custodial staff and one lead. Operating during the hours of 6:30 AM to 3:30 PM, this manager will be instrumental in driving client and patient satisfaction by ensuring high standards of cleanliness and safety are consistently met. Reporting directly to the Director, the role demands strong leadership skills to supervise daily activities, manage team performance, and implement departmental projects and initiatives, all while collaborating closely with the Infectious Control department to uphold rigorous hygiene protocols vital to a healthcare setting.

This position requires a candidate capable of operating within a dynamic healthcare environment where attention to detail and adherence to safety standards are paramount. The manager will be responsible for effectively managing the Unit Operating System, tracking departmental metrics, and supporting a diverse and inclusive workforce. Candidates must be prepared to work every other weekend and rotate holidays, reinforcing the commitment to maintaining continuous quality service for the hospital. Additionally, the role involves the completion of a second-level background check, underscoring the sensitive nature of the healthcare environment.
